Heutzutage gibt es für alles ein Akronym. Durchstöbern Sie unser Glossar für Softwaredesign und -entwicklung, um eine Definition für diese lästigen Fachbegriffe zu finden.
Java-Bytecode ist ein entscheidender Aspekt der Java-Programmierung, der von vielen Entwicklern oft übersehen wird. In diesem Artikel werden wir untersuchen, was Java-Bytecode ist, warum er wichtig ist und wie er Softwareentwicklungsunternehmen zugutekommen kann.
Java-Bytecode ist die Zwischenrepräsentation von Java-Code, die vom Java-Compiler generiert wird. Es handelt sich um eine niedrigstufige, plattformunabhängige Sprache, die von der Java Virtual Machine (JVM) ausgeführt wird. Java-Bytecode ist im Wesentlichen der Maschinencode, den die JVM versteht und ausführt, um Java-Programme auszuführen.
Ein wesentlicher Vorteil von Java-Bytecode ist seine Plattformunabhängigkeit. Da Java-Bytecode von der JVM ausgeführt wird, können Java-Programme auf jeder Plattform laufen, auf der eine kompatible JVM installiert ist. Das bedeutet, dass Entwickler sich keine Gedanken darüber machen müssen, separaten Code für verschiedene Plattformen zu schreiben, was Java zu einer vielseitigen und effizienten Programmiersprache macht.
Ein weiterer Vorteil von Java-Bytecode sind seine Sicherheitsfunktionen. Java-Bytecode ist so konzipiert, dass er sicher und geschützt ist, mit integrierten Funktionen wie Typüberprüfung und automatischer Speicherverwaltung. Dies hilft, häufige Sicherheitsanfälligkeiten wie Pufferüberläufe und Speicherlecks zu verhindern, wodurch Java-Programme robuster und sicherer werden.
Für Softwareentwicklungsunternehmen kann das Verständnis von Java-Bytecode einen Wettbewerbsvorteil in der Branche bieten. Durch die Nutzung der Möglichkeiten von Java-Bytecode können Entwickler effizienteren und skalierbaren Code schreiben, der nahtlos auf jeder Plattform läuft. Dies kann Unternehmen helfen, qualitativ hochwertige Softwareprodukte schneller und kosteneffizienter an ihre Kunden zu liefern.
Darüber hinaus kann das Wissen über Java-Bytecode Softwareentwicklungsunternehmen auch dabei helfen, ihren Code für die Leistung zu optimieren. Durch das Verständnis, wie Java-Bytecode von der JVM ausgeführt wird, können Entwickler Engpässe und Ineffizienzen in ihrem Code identifizieren und notwendige Optimierungen vornehmen, um die Leistung zu verbessern.
Insgesamt ist Java-Bytecode ein leistungsstarkes Werkzeug, das Softwareentwicklungsunternehmen in vielerlei Hinsicht zugutekommen kann. Durch das Verständnis und die Nutzung der Möglichkeiten von Java-Bytecode können Entwickler sichereren, effizienteren und skalierbaren Code schreiben, der den Bedürfnissen ihrer Kunden entspricht. Wenn Sie also nach einem Softwareentwicklungsunternehmen suchen, das die Feinheiten von Java-Bytecode versteht, sind Sie hier genau richtig. Kontaktieren Sie uns noch heute, um mehr darüber zu erfahren, wie wir Ihnen helfen können, Ihre Ziele in der Softwareentwicklung zu erreichen.
Vielleicht ist es der Beginn einer schönen Freundschaft?